Mission Overview:
Keystone Solutions is seeking an IAM Engineer to join a long-term consultancy mission with our client in Brussels. As a Keystone Solutions consultant, you will work closely with the client's architect and program manager to define and coordinate tasks that deploy a unified Identity and Access Management (IAM) solution, such as SailPoint, for the group. This mission includes the following objectives, to be executed on-site or in a hybrid model with the client:
- Automated user lifecycle (Joiner-Mover-Leaver).
- Role-Based Access Control (RBAC) with Segregation of Duties (SoD) management.
- Automated access provisioning.
- Integration with core systems: Entra ID and ServiceNow.
- Integration with HR referential systems.
- Central governance and compliance across all organizations in scope.
- Centralized catalog of access requests and approval workflows with ServiceNow.
French and English are required for this mission.

Key Responsibilities:
- Contribute as a Keystone Solutions consultant to define, plan, and coordinate the IAM workstreams required to deploy a unified IAM platform (such as SailPoint) for the group.
- Collaborate with the client's architect and program manager to align scope, milestones, and priorities for the long-term program.
- Design and oversee implementation of automated user lifecycle (Joiner-Mover-Leaver) processes.
- Establish RBAC models with clear role engineering and Segregation of Duties (SoD) rules, including conflict detection and remediation workflows.
- Define and support automated access provisioning across target systems.
- Coordinate integrations with core systems: Entra ID and ServiceNow.
- Coordinate integration with HR referential systems for authoritative source data and identity attributes.
- Set up and reinforce central IAM governance and compliance controls across all organizations in scope.
- Design and maintain a centralized access request catalog and approval workflows using ServiceNow.
- Document functional and technical requirements, process flows, and controls; contribute to testing, validation, and user training as needed.
- Track progress, risks, and dependencies; report regularly to client stakeholders and Keystone Solutions engagement lead.
